Bazha (Chinese: 巴扎乡) is a village and township in Bainang County, in the Shigatse prefecture-level city of the Tibet Autonomous Region of China. At the time of the 2010 census, the township had a population of 5,134.[1]As of 2013, it had 13 villages under its administration.
